# This is a basic workflow to help you get started with Actions
name: Build
# Controls when the workflow will run
on:
# Triggers the workflow on push or pull request events but only for the master branch
push:
branches:
- master
pull_request:
types: [opened, synchronize, reopened]
# Allows you to run this workflow manually from the Actions tab
workflow_dispatch:
# A workflow run is made up of one or more jobs that can run sequentially or in parallel
jobs:
# This workflow contains a single job called "build"
build:
# The type of runner that the job will run on
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
# Steps represent a sequence of tasks that will be executed as part of the job
steps:
- name: Checkout the code
uses: actions/checkout@v4
with:
fetch-depth: 0
- name: set up JDK 21
uses: actions/setup-java@v4
with:
java-version: '21'
distribution: 'zulu'
- name: Cache SonarCloud packages
uses: actions/cache@v4
with:
path: ~/.sonar/cache
key: ${{ runner.os }}-sonar
restore-keys: ${{ runner.os }}-sonar
- name: Cache Gradle packages
uses: actions/cache@v4
with:
path: ~/.gradle/caches
key: ${{ runner.os }}-gradle-${{ hashFiles('**/*.gradle') }}
restore-keys: ${{ runner.os }}-gradle
- name: Make gradlew executable
run: chmod +x ./gradlew
- name: Build the app
run: ./gradlew build
- name: Build the tests
run: ./gradlew test
- name: Build and analyze (master)
env:
GITHUB_TOKEN: ${{ secrets.GITHUB_TOKEN }} # Needed to get PR information, if any
SONAR_TOKEN: ${{ secrets.SONAR_TOKEN }}
run: ./gradlew build sonarqube --info
if: github.event_name != 'pull_request'
- name: Build and analyze (PR)
run: echo 'Temporarily disabled'
if: github.event_name == 'pull_request'
